Toxoptera aurantii. [Distribution map].
Abstract A new distribution map is provided for Toxoptera aurantii (Boy.) (Homopt., Aphidae) (Black Citrus Aphid) Hosts: Citrus, cacao, coffee, tea, Cola, etc. Information is given on the geographical distribution in EUROPE (excl.USSR), Britain, France, Germany, Greece, Italy, Malta, Sardinia, Sicily, Spain, ASIA (excl.USSR), Burma, Ceylon, China, Cyprus, Formosa, India, Indo-China, Indonesia, Israel, Japan, Lebanon, Malaya, North Borneo, Philippine Islands, Ryukyu Islands, Syria, Turkey, USSR, AFRICA, Angola, Cameroun, Republic Congo, Dahomey, Egypt, Eritrea, Gaboon, Gambia, Ghana, Ivory Coast, Kenya, Libya, Mauritius, Morocco, Nigeria, Nyasaland, Principe, Republic of Congo, Republic of South Africa, St. Helena, San Thomé, Sierra Leone, Somalia, Southern Rhodesia, Tanganyika, Tunisia, Uganda, AUSTRALASIA and PACIFIC ISLANDS, Australia, Caroline Islands, Fiji, Hawaii, Mariana Islands, Marquesas Islands, New Caledonia, New Guinea, New Hebrides, New Zealand, Papua and New Guinea, Samoa, Solomon Islands, Wallis Island, NORTH AMERICA, Mexico, U.S.A., CENTRAL AMERICA and WEST INDIES, Costa Rica, El Salvador, Guatemala, Nicaragua, West Indies, SOUTH AMERICA, Argentina, Bolivia, Brazil, British Guiana, Chile, Colombia, Ecuador, Peru, Surinam, Uruguay, Venezuela.
